The Rivertown Industrial Center was sold to a Chicago-based firm for $13.4 million.
The 251,000-square-foot distribution center, located at 375 Rivertown Drive, was sold to First Industrial Realty Trust, according to CBRE, which represented the seller, HIgh Street Equity Advisors LLC. High Street is a private equity real estate firm that focuses on institutional properties in the eastern half of the United States (including the Midwest and Texas).
Built in 1997, the Woodbury building is 100 percent occupied by two tenants.
